Structure Resources is seeking Electrical Project Managers to join our client's traveling Mission Critical team. This is a direct-hire opportunity with an innovative electrical contractor that has a strong team environment and ample room for upward mobility.
They are looking for Project Managers who have experience managing large commercial projects and some Data Center or Mission Critical experience in their background.
This includes: accountable for the management of assigned projects including the installation, performance, profitability, and customer satisfaction of projects.
The ideal candidate will also have experience performing all work within an established time frame and ensuring that work is done in conformance with quality work standards, projected man-hours, within established company guidelines and regulatory compliance requirements. Also schedules, participates in and/or conducts project meetings.
